In our first session together, here's what you can expect

Our first session is all about getting to know you. We’ll take time to talk about what brought you to therapy, what you’re hoping to work on, and what you need to feel supported. I’ll explain my approach so you know what to expect, and we’ll move at your pace with no pressure, no judgment. Think of it as a conversation, not an interview. By the end of the session, we’ll have a clearer sense of your goals and how we can work together to get you where you want to be emotionally, mentally, and personally.
